Tracking MY22 orders flipping to MY23
I figured I'd make a thread on this for all of us who are waiting at 105 status that we can communicate when our builds flip to MY23. If that actually happens automatically or if we're forced to place new orders will be seen soon and we can report back here for everyone.
I've only seen a couple people say this occurred for them outside the USA. No one in North America has said this has occurred yet, and yet people are able to place new orders for MY23 and get production numbers and scheduled dates. So let's track it and see what happens, what our CA's say, etc, in one place. I have an email out to my CA this morning asking what the procedure is as the last 2 weeks of June in 2022 MY are not likely to come to fruition of having my car move to 150 and be built.

So, I can confirm that those in status 105 with a MY22 were automatically swapped for a 2023. I had a 2022 production number that just became 2023 on it's own and shows as scheduled for production.
